1. Core Topic:

The overarching topic is the relationship between uric‍ acid levels (often ‍associated with gout) and broader metabolic health, specifically diabetes and cardiovascular disease. the articles⁢ highlight that high uric acid can be an early indicator of problems beyond just gout,signaling potential risks for diabetes,insulin resistance,heart ⁤disease,and stroke.
